MegAnne Ford — From “Be Better” to Feel Better: Parenting Complex Kids with CLEAR Connection
In this conversation, Michelle sits down with parent coach MegAnne Ford to flip the old script—away from forcing kids to fit our vision and toward building skills, safety, and connection so families actually feel better day to day.
MegAnne shares:
Why control backfires. Traditional “make them comply” tactics widen the gap; centering the child’s needs helps the message land.
The CLEAR method (her 5-step roadmap).
Connection → Limits → Empowerment → Accountability → Recovery—so consequences teach with dignity, not shame.
Behavior = a nervous system message. Nonverbals shout louder than words; listen, mirror, validate before you problem-solve.
Grief and the pivot. When diagnoses or differences rewrite your plan, community shortens the lonely middle.
Connection is the superpower. Online cohorts that become real-life support—through IEP seasons, moves, meltdowns, and milestones.
Quote to tape on the fridge:
“You’re enough. Let people come in and love on you.”
Whether you’re navigating autism, ADHD, anxiety, or big feelings that don’t fit a checklist, MegAnne’s message is simple: connection before correction—and repeat it with CLEAR steps until home feels safer for everyone.
